Otherwise, in general, my advice would be: Ignore them. Avoid them. Laugh when they tease you, so they don't have the satisfaction of upsetting you! The more irritated you get, the more they will tease you, so don't let them see that anything they say bothers you. And don't try to convince them of anything. Trying to convince a fool is a waste of time and energy. Don't lower yourself to their level by trying to argue with them. They are only interested in upsetting you. You won't be in school forever, and in the wide world there are, of course, stupid people, but there are also intelligent ones, and the intelligent ones are the ones you want to seek out for your friends.
